Ok so an interesting thing happened to me. Everything was working fine and then just suddenly internet explorer screwed up. I was watching a movie on amazon, after the movie was over I left for a few minutes. When I got back there was a notice up, the typical IE error and restart message, but it is just a endless loop. The moment I click close it reopens IE and the error comes up again. it doesn't provide any information about the problem. It doesn't matter how many times I close it just keeps looping and the only way to stop it is to restart the computer. Cannot stop the loop from task manager either.
At least I happened to have Win 10 installed on one of my other hard drives so I could get online to try and find a way to fix it.
I've disabled and re-enabled IE from the windows features and no change.
Any suggestions as to what to try next? oh and everything else is working fine.

My roommates windows 7 machine / IE 11 just did the same thing about 2 hours ago. I reverted back to a system restore point from this morning and it worked fine after that. The wild part is that mine just took a dump about 10 minutes ago with the same infinite loop!!!! GRRRRRRR!!!
Thankfully I have multiple browsers installed. Restoring advanced settings does not help, nor does completely resetting IE in control panel - internet options - advanced tab... so don't even both b/c I already tried that first.
